buraksonmez.bsky.social
Boundaries can shift, but unevenly!

Perspective-taking boosts support for asylum rights & faster decisions

However, loss-framed cost info has no effect on rights, just some in charitable giving

Overall, empathy works better to widen moral boundaries!
buraksonmez.bsky.social
Spatial preferences mirror these hierarchies: Ukrainians & English-speaking professionals welcomed; Muslim, low-status, non-English-speaking refugees resisted locally
buraksonmez.bsky.social
We found that perceived legitimacy is layered, not just forced vs voluntary

Absent/fake ID erodes legitimacy, especially for Muslim applicants

Symbolic vulnerability (minors, women, kinship) + strategic merit (occupation) → hierarchies of protection
